"Raimondo Urges 'Different Tools' in Response to Huawei Chip"
TL;DR Summary
US Commerce Secretary Gina Raimondo expressed concern over reports of a chip breakthrough by Huawei Technologies, emphasizing the need for additional tools and resources to enforce export-control regulations. Raimondo mentioned a stalled legislative proposal and an alternative framework to mitigate risk in the tech supply chain. She declined to comment on the progress of the Commerce Department's probe into a new Huawei smartphone powered by an advanced 7-nanometer chip. Raimondo faced political pressure to tighten controls on China's technological advancement while the administration seeks to improve ties with Beijing.
